Construction method for pipe-following drilling micro pile of slewing drilling machine
The invention discloses a construction method for a pipe-following drilling micro pile of a slewing drilling machine. The drilling machine is installed in place, and the orientations and angles of a drill pipe and a drill bit are adjusted to be uniform with design parameters; after preparation, drilling starts to be performed; a direct cycle method is adopted, and circulating water is utilized for cooling the drill bit and removing slag; a wall-protecting steel casing pipe follows and is pressed synchronously every time drilling is performed by 0.25 m-0.5 m, and the distance between the wall-protecting steel casing pipe and the bottom of a hole is smaller than or equal to 0.5 m; every time drilling is performed by 1 m-2 m, the angle of the drill pipe is checked one time; after reaching a designed depth, the drill pipe and a drilling tool are taken out; fine aggregate concrete or cement mortar is injected into the wall-protecting steel casing pipe; after the concrete or the cement mortar is solidified, the pipe-following drilling micro pile for reinforcing roadbeds of existing high-speed railways is formed. Soil body disturbance of the roadbed can be avoided to the maximum degree, and roadbed additive deformation caused by regulation of project construction is prevented. Construction can be performed under the driving conditions of the existing high-speed railways, and normal operation of existing lines is not affected; the construction method is suitable for performing disease regulation on roadbed deformation occurring on the existing high-speed railways.
